Far Cry Primal eGuide Takkar's Journey Main Missions Wogah the Crafter

Trapped

Trapped

Prerequisite: Complete Attack of the Udam

Main Objective: Escape the Cave

Difficulty: Easy

Awards: 500 XP

Special: Grappling Claw

Enemies: Jaguars

Overview

Once the Udam attack has been thwarted, new specialists appear on the map. Find and bring them back to the village to gain new skills and upgrades. Wogah the Crafter is found in a cave near the Shelter of the Lost. Climb the vines just to the east of this location and follow the wood path back west to find the cave. Enter to begin the Trapped mission.

Strategy

Wogah thinks he has caught another Udam and does not believe you are Wenja. You must find a way out of the cave to convince him otherwise.

Light your torch and set the debris on fire to reveal a hole. Drop down to the lower level.

Head northwest to find a Leopard, tending to another Leopard carcass, and (if you have the skill) tame it with a piece of bait. Walk over to the body and pick up the grappling claw stuck in its side. This is an extremely useful tool as it allows for climbing and swinging to new heights.

Return to the first cavern and spot a grappling point to the right. Use the claw to reach the ledge above and move to the end of the corridor.

Turn left and use the grappling claw to swing across the gap. Another grapple point allows you to descend into a big cavern below.

Four Jaguars attack as soon as you get within range, so be ready to keep them away with your torch. Climb out of the pit to the west and use the grappling claw on a point high up the right wall.

Continue up the wall ahead by ascending toward the first grapple point and switching to the next one when possible. You find an exit just ahead.
